What can I do with old loose hay?

That old, low quality hay crop has value!

If the hay is beyond use for feed and there is no local bedding market, another option is to send old hay into the “mulch” or “mushroom compost” market. Mushroom composters want orchardgrass or timothy hay that is mature hay or last year’s hay.

Do hay bales stop flooding?

A straw bale barrier is a temporary entrenched and anchored barrier used to intercept sediment-laden runoff and to provide some retention of sediment from small drainage areas. A straw bale barrier can be used to promote sheet flow and to reduce runoff velocity, thus reducing erosion and improving water quality.

How many round bales can you get per acre?

There are 3 basic sizes. Large round rolls of which you can get about 5 per acre. Then you have a large rectangular bale of which you get about 40 per acre. Small rectangular bales of which you can get about 100.

How much does a round bale of hay weigh?

between 1200-1700 lb
A typical round hay bale can weigh anywhere between 1200-1700 lb (544-771 kg). Alfalfa hay of round hay bales weigh around 1200-2000 lb (544-907 kg), a three-string bale of alfalfa weighs approx 110-140 lb (50-63.5 kg) and a small two-string bale can weigh anywhere between 60-70 lb (27-31.8 kg).

How do you feed round bale hay?

Round bales stored outside, uncovered and on the ground and fed in unrolled, exposed bales or in simple open-sided ring feeders will have the biggest losses, easily 30 -50%. In contrast, bales stored inside or covered, off the ground and fed unrolled or in cone-style feeders can limit losses to 5-15%.

How do you keep round bales off the ground?

Plastic wrap, net wrap or tarps can be used to prevent loss from weathering. Don’t stack bales on top of each other unless the entire stack is to be covered. Large, round bales should be stored in the open, not under shade and have good air circulation.
